The final assembly for the products in the industries such as automobile, constructionmachinery and equipment manufacturing, is a complex engineering involves numerousfactors like personnel, equipment, material, method and environment. In the digital executionand monitoring for assembly, it faces many requirements and challenges. The informationcollection is consuming time and lagging. It needs more exact and timely monitoring. Withthe development of the Internet of Things, the advanced digital technology like wirelesssensor networks realizes the ubiquitous connections between object and human and Providesa new solution way for the intelligentize manufacturing execution.For the problems and requirements in the assembly process, this paper does the researchon the key technology of wireless sensor networks for the application in the assemblyworkshop in the basis of the characteristics of wireless sensor networks. The main research isas below:It summarizes the characteristics of the assembly workshop and analyses the applicationrequirement in the aspects of the production process dynamic perception, the equipmentresource real-time monitoring and the logistics procedure lean management and studies theusability of wireless sensor networks. At last, it brings the key technology for the applicationof wireless sensor networks from the aspects of route design, data collection, closed-loopmonitoring.Facing the complex application environment in the assembly workshop, this paper putsforward the improved routing algorithm on the basis of LEACH. The simulation shows thatthe improved route algorithm has the better energy balanced performance, which lengthensthe network life cycle.Facing the application requirement for getting the state real-time information in theassembly workshop accurately, this paper designs the data collection system combined with the existing network in the company and realizes the system from aspects of node’s hardware,node’s software and system platform. The system realizes the real-time comprehensiveperception for the states in the workshop and has good flexibility and expansibility.Facing the application requirement for remote monitoring the equipment resource in theassembly workshop neatly, this paper takes the PLC as the example and designs theclosed-loop monitoring system combined with wireless sensor network. The system canrealize the ubiquitous closed-loop monitoring from the execution of control command to thegetting of state information. At last, it realizes the application targeting to the station materialdistribution.
